About me

I am currently licensed in both Illinois and Iowa with 21 years of professional work experience, working with individuals of all backgrounds, cultures, and socioeconomic statuses. During my career I have worked with individuals with vastly different needs allowing me to feel comfortable assisting each with the particular goals they have for themselves. I have experience in assisting clients with a variety of issues or concerns including mood and personality disorders, stress, anxiety (including panic), and depression, coping with addictions including both substance use as well as intimacy/sexual related, & trauma and abuse. I have experience working with several additional areas of concern people may have. I am a licensed clinical counselor as well as certified in advanced addictions work and have experience in school counseling and working with school systems and clients (to better assist working with schools and needs students and parents may have as well as with IEP and 504s). I believe in treating everyone with respect, sensitivity, and compassion. I will tailor our dialog and treatment plan to meet your unique and specific needs.
